## Service Accounts — StormFan Alert Fan-Out

The fan-out worker authenticates to the internal dispatch tier using the svc-stormfan account. Rotate quarterly; scopes are limited to publish-only on alert topics. If deliveries stall during your shift, verify the worker is using the current credential, reproduced below for reference.

API key for kaweg-hahif: kto4_rAjZ

# Artifact Signing — Pingloft Deploy Bot

Pingloft posts deploy status to team channels. Its binaries are signed at build time by the `sigwrap` stage; unsigned artifacts are rejected by the Corvel fleet. Rotate signatures quarterly. Verify with `sigwrap verify` before promotion — a mismatch usually means a stale build cache, so purge and rebuild rather than re-signing. Never sign locally built binaries for production. CI signs everything with the shared release key, recorded below for verification purposes.

deploy key for yagap-kawig: bky4_Q8dK

# Break-Glass: Catalog Cache Invalidation

Scope: the Pinrow product catalog at Veldstone Retail. If stale prices persist after a purge and the Hollowmere invalidation queue is wedged, use break-glass to flush the edge tier directly. Contractors: get verbal sign-off from the catalog lead first. Steps: open the Hollowmere admin shell, select emergency-flush, confirm the tenant, and run it once — repeated flushes thrash the origin. Access is logged and expires after 20 minutes. Unseal the admin shell with the passphrase below.

recovery phrase for kahop-tajog: istix-casvan